Zwischen Wahnsinn und Realitaet
2 Domains auf ein Server mit Rewriterule
Mein Problem:
Um einen Vhost für Apache nutzen zu können, muss ein Alias auf dem Nameserver angelegt werden in ein A Record.
Da dies bei mir nicht möglich ist auf Grund meiner Dynamischen IP musste ich mir was anderes einfallen lassen.
Die Lösung:
In der .htacces kann man eine Rewriterule eintragen, die eine Subdomain auf einen separaten Ordner umleiten lässt – wichtig, ist der Ordner muss gleich heißen wie in der Rewriterule angegeben:
Mein Beispiel:
Hauptdomain: www.lordmat.de
Subdomain: ebrett.lordmat.de
Ordner in /var/www: ebrett
Rewriterule:
RewriteCond %{HTTP_HOST} ^[www\.]*ebrett.lordmat.de [NC]
RewriteCond %{REQUEST_URI} !^/ebrett/.*
RewriteRule ^(.*) ebrett/$1/ [L]
| Artikel drucken | Dieser Beitrag wurde von Matze am 5. Februar 2010 um 19:36 veröffentlicht und unter Anleitung abgelegt. Du kannst allen Antworten zu diesem Beitrag durch RSS 2.0 folgen. Du kannst eine Antwort schreiben oder einen Trackback von deiner eigenen Seite hinterlassen. |







vor 5 Monaten
Es wär auch einfacher gegangen, das Szenario was Du für den Hosteintrag “www” vor “lordmat.de” eingerichtet hast, kannst Du auch für jeden beliebigen anderen Eitrag so einrichten!
Bsp:
ebrett.lordmat.de (cname) -> ebrett.selfip.biz -> (A) -> Deine dyn-IP
Bei Fragen einfach melden…
Gruß, Filip
vor 5 Monaten
Das habe ich ja gemacht – sonst würde ebrett net den gleichen dyn Eintrag wie www haben
Apache hat es aber wohl nicht ganz verstanden, oder ich hatte einen Fehler in der vhost.conf, das kann ich in dem Fall nicht ausschließen
Jedenfalls geht es mit der Rewriterule genauso